- // Part of the Carbon Language project, under the Apache License v2.0 with LLVM
- // Exceptions. See /LICENSE for license information.
- // S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
- #include "common/error.h"
- #include <gtest/gtest.h>
- #include "testing/base/test_raw_ostream.h"
- namespace Carbon::Testing {
- namespace {
- TEST(ErrorTest, Error) {
- Error err("test");
- EXPECT_EQ(err.message(), "test");
- }
- TEST(ErrorTest, ErrorEmptyString) {
- ASSERT_DEATH({ Error err(""); }, "CHECK failure at");
- }
- auto IndirectError() -> Error { return Error("test"); }
- TEST(ErrorTest, IndirectError) { EXPECT_EQ(IndirectError().message(), "test"); }
- TEST(ErrorTest, ErrorOr) {
- ErrorOr<int> err(Error("test"));
- EXPECT_FALSE(err.ok());
- EXPECT_EQ(err.error().message(), "test");
- }
- TEST(ErrorTest, ErrorOrValue) { EXPECT_TRUE(ErrorOr<int>(0).ok()); }
- auto IndirectErrorOrTest() -> ErrorOr<int> { return Error("test"); }
- TEST(ErrorTest, IndirectErrorOr) { EXPECT_FALSE(IndirectErrorOrTest().ok()); }
- struct Val {
- int val;
- };
- TEST(ErrorTest, ErrorOrArrowOp) {
- ErrorOr<Val> err({1});
- EXPECT_EQ(err->val, 1);
- }
- auto IndirectErrorOrSuccessTest() -> ErrorOr<Success> { return Success(); }
- TEST(ErrorTest, IndirectErrorOrSuccess) {
- EXPECT_TRUE(IndirectErrorOrSuccessTest().ok());
- }
- TEST(ErrorTest, ReturnIfErrorNoError) {
- auto result = []() -> ErrorOr<Success> {
- CARBON_RETURN_IF_ERROR(ErrorOr<Success>(Success()));
- CARBON_RETURN_IF_ERROR(ErrorOr<Success>(Success()));
- return Success();
- }();
- EXPECT_TRUE(result.ok());
- }
- TEST(ErrorTest, ReturnIfErrorHasError) {
- auto result = []() -> ErrorOr<Success> {
- CARBON_RETURN_IF_ERROR(ErrorOr<Success>(Success()));
- CARBON_RETURN_IF_ERROR(ErrorOr<Success>(Error("error")));
- return Success();
- }();
- ASSERT_FALSE(result.ok());
- EXPECT_EQ(result.error().message(), "error");
- }
- TEST(ErrorTest, AssignOrReturnNoError) {
- auto result = []() -> ErrorOr<int> {
- CARBON_ASSIGN_OR_RETURN(int a, ErrorOr<int>(1));
- CARBON_ASSIGN_OR_RETURN(const int b, ErrorOr<int>(2));
- int c = 0;
- CARBON_ASSIGN_OR_RETURN(c, ErrorOr<int>(3));
- return a + b + c;
- }();
- ASSERT_TRUE(result.ok());
- EXPECT_EQ(6, *result);
- }
- TEST(ErrorTest, AssignOrReturnHasDirectError) {
- auto result = []() -> ErrorOr<int> {
- CARBON_RETURN_IF_ERROR(ErrorOr<int>(Error("error")));
- return 0;
- }();
- ASSERT_FALSE(result.ok());
- }
- TEST(ErrorTest, AssignOrReturnHasErrorInExpected) {
- auto result = []() -> ErrorOr<int> {
- CARBON_ASSIGN_OR_RETURN(int a, ErrorOr<int>(Error("error")));
- return a;
- }();
- ASSERT_FALSE(result.ok());
- EXPECT_EQ(result.error().message(), "error");
- }
- TEST(ErrorTest, ErrorBuilderOperatorImplicitCast) {
- ErrorOr<int> result = ErrorBuilder() << "msg";
- ASSERT_FALSE(result.ok());
- EXPECT_EQ(result.error().message(), "msg");
- }
- TEST(ErrorTest, StreamError) {
- Error result = ErrorBuilder("TestFunc") << "msg";
- TestRawOstream result_stream;
- result_stream << result;
- EXPECT_EQ(result_stream.TakeStr(), "TestFunc: msg");
- }
- } // namespace
- } // namespace Carbon::Testing
